Planning Before the Wedding Day

Good wedding photography starts well before the ceremony. Communication between the couple and photographer can make a significant difference.

A pre-wedding consultation gives you an opportunity to discuss your expectations, preferred photography style, important people, and schedule. You can also talk about specific photographs you would like captured, such as family portraits, wedding rings, invitations, flowers, or other meaningful details.

Creating a photography timeline can also help keep the day organized. Your photographer can coordinate with the overall wedding schedule so there is enough time for portraits without making you feel rushed.

Choosing the Right Photography Style

Every couple has different preferences. Some prefer traditional and timeless portraits, while others enjoy documentary-style photography that focuses on candid moments. Some couples may prefer a combination of classic portraits, artistic compositions, and natural photographs.

Before choosing a photographer, review complete wedding galleries rather than looking only at a few favorite images. A full gallery can show how consistently the photographer handles different lighting situations, locations, emotions, and parts of the wedding day.

It is also important to choose someone whose communication style makes you comfortable. You will spend significant time with your photographer, so professionalism, reliability, and a calm approach can be just as important as photographic skill.
